Uncorrected OCR: K.4038
KA.284.15
1:10
Deep bowl (frag.)
H.pres. 0.19, D.rim est. 0.50,
Th. 0.019/0.008. Less than 20% pres.;
mended.
C, House E, Room II, upper debris level,
at ca. 2.80.
C 914
XLVIII.46
KPR.337
Coarse orange-brown biscuit; hand-made,
fairly hard-baked with a clink when hit.
Scored ware: surface is marked by
striations of a smoothing-tool (diagonal
lines on exterior, more or less horiz-
ontal on interior).
Plain flat rim. Profile curves in
somewhat toward
rim.
(over)
One horizontal lug handle preserved, about
0.09 long. There are bulges on interior
where the handle was attached.
Plastic decoration: two bands of applied discs,
one band at rim, the other at handle zone.
Period I L
DEW III-112
